Margaret Howe Bond 1909–1978 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 21 Oct 1909

Birth Location: Webster Groves, St. Louis, Missouri

Death Date: 8 Dec 1978

Death Location: Decatur, Dekalb County, Georgia

Father: Read Bond

Mother: Emily Russell

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

Margaret Howe Bond was born in 1909 in Webster Groves, St. Louis, Missouri, the child of Read Pugh Bond And Emily Howe Russell. Margaret Howe Bond passed away in 1978 in Decatur, Dekalb County, Georgia.
